Lt. Gov. Patrick: Texas Rangers on Case of Tom Bradys Jersey Theft

Texas Insider Report: AUSTIN Texas Lt. Gov. Dan Patrick has asked the Texas Rangers to assist the Houston Police Department in finding New England Patriots Quarterback Tom Bradys jersey which was stolen from the Patriots locker room at NRG Stadium in Houston last night. Brady wore the jersey during the Patriots comeback victory in the Super Bowl.
In Texas we place a very high value on hospitality and football. Tom Bradys jersey has great historical value and is already being called the most valuable NFL collectable ever. It will likely go into the Hall of Fame one day. It is important that history does not record that it was stolen in Texas. Ive called Colonel Steve McCraw to ask that the Texas Rangers work with the Houston Police Department on this case. "Im a Texans and Cowboys fan first but the unquestionable success of the Super Bowl in Houston last night was a big win for our entire state and I dont want anything to mar that victory. Whoever took this jersey should turn it in. The Texas Rangers are on the trail.
